You should not use over the counter whitening treatments if you have problems such as gum disease, tooth decay or cavities. These whitening treatments contain some very strong chemicals that could cause a lot of pain and damage if you apply them over damaged teeth or if they come in content with diseased gums.

Take care of your tooth brush. Rinse your tooth brush thoroughly after use. Store it in an upright position, allowing it to air dry. Try not to leave your tooth brush in an enclosed area. This could encourage the growth of bacteria or even mold. If the cleanliness of your toothbrush is compromised, replace it immediately.

Make sure that the toothpaste you use contains fluoride. While there are natural toothpastes available that do not list this as an ingredient, they do not provide the level of protection fluoride does. You have a much higher chance of developing dental issues if you use one of these brands.

Do you frequently consume foods and beverages that are acidic, such as tomatoes, citrus fruits, wine, sports and energy drinks and coffee? The acid in these products can erode the enamel on your teeth. Do not brush your teeth soon after consuming any of these items. If you do, you are actually brushing the acids into your teeth. Instead, rinse your mouth with water and wait at least a half hour before brushing your teeth.
